Transaction 5636a614ade27c1823e475062e186e224b2df189ca99cb2a78689a165981039a

1 Input
2 Outputs
  • 5636a614ade27c1823e475062e186e224b2df189ca99cb2a78689a165981039a:0
  • value  199108
    address  3KeskEuymTR6r9zSNALgyPhWyhsWbT81iD
  • 5636a614ade27c1823e475062e186e224b2df189ca99cb2a78689a165981039a:1
  • value  500000
    address  3PXPrYezjQ678wPkeapicMypyCagQWB3mH